Abstract:

CirkArena is a planned modern centre supporting the circular economy in the Moravian-Silesian Region. Its main goal is to transform the region into a model of sustainable development, focusing on research and efficient use of industrial waste such as slag, dust, bio-waste and building materials. The project will contribute to the transformation of the region by maximising the use of secondary raw materials, promoting the sustainability and modernisation of businesses and linking industries, leading to a reduction in waste and promoting a circular economy. CirkArena is part of the wider SMARt And Green District (SMARAGD) initiative, which integrates materials, energy, environment and IT to ensure a sustainable future for the region.
